» Delete accounts: Swipe up > Settings > Accounts, then tap the account name and Remove account. Duo Sign in with your Google account to make and receive video calls. Find it: Swipe up > Duo View settings. Moto Explore special features designed to save you time and make your day easier. Find it: Moto > » Moto Actions: Use gestures as phone shortcuts. » Moto Display: See your notifications at a glance. Note: Your phone may not have all features. Tap the contacts icon to find a contact, or tap LET'S GO to invite friends. » Start a new video call: Tap the search box, then type or tap a name in your contacts to start the video call. » Preview incoming calls: See live video of the caller before you answer. To turn this off for both the caller and receiver, tap Menu > Settings > Knock Knock. » Change settings: Tap Menu > Settings to change the vibration setting, block numbers, and more. » Call anyone: Duo works across platforms, allowing you to call friends with the Duo app on any device. Tip: When on a video call, your phone will automatically switch from cellular network to Wi-Fi, if available. Moto greeting page. Moto application is used to customize your phone. Moto Actions Enhance your phone with gestures and actions. Find it: Moto > > Moto Actions » Quick Capture: Twist your wrist twice quickly to open the front camera. » Fast flashlight: Turn the flashlight on/off with two chopping motions. » Three finger screenshot: Touch and hold the screen with three fingertips to capture a screenshot. » Screenshot editor: Edit and share your screenshots.
